通过segue传递对象

杰里米·埃文斯(Jeremy Evans)

长话短说,我有一个正在与我的gf一起工作的项目。这是一本针对素食者的纯素食食谱书,可让吃肉的人或恶魔对付素食者,或者只吃纯素的素食主义者。任何人,在将数据从视图表传递到视图控制器时都遇到问题。似乎我第一次推送单元格为零。然后我回击然后再次击中它,但是通过...但是,一旦我再次回击它,就像我的数组用源切换名称一样。提供的所提供项目的链接,因为此处输入的代码太多。

链接到项目

斯凯勒·劳伦(Skyler Lauren)

我花了点时间来追踪它,但我相信您的问题是您试图直接从表格单元格中搜索。在您可以设置实例变量之前,将先进行设置。

删除故事板上的那个序列,然后重新创建它,直接从“配方列表”到“配方信息”。不要忘记重新输入您的segue标识符。

现在,在didSelectRow中调用它应该是一个简单的问题

-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ath
{
    // Set selected location to var
    _selectedLocation = _feedItems[indexPath.row];

    [self performSegueWithIdentifier:@"recipeInfo" sender:nil];
}

同样,将来您的项目可能会很复杂,但是您大致知道问题的出处。输入RecipeList.m,RecipeInfo.h和RecipeInfo.m的代码将最能引导您找到可以帮助您的地方,而无需深入研究项目。如果有人不愿意深入研究您的项目,那么就不要抱怨,而只是想帮助您更快地回答问题。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

通过segue传递UIImage

来自分类Dev

通过segue传递tableviewcell数据?

来自分类Dev

通过segue传递类型为User的值

来自分类Dev

通过Segue传递字符串

来自分类Dev

iOS委托,而不是通过segue传递数据

来自分类Dev

通过Segue传递数据(目标C)

来自分类Dev

通过自定义segue传递数据

来自分类Dev

通过TabBarControllerController使用segue传递数据

来自分类Dev

通过Segue将文本传递到TextView

来自分类Dev

通过函数传递对象

来自分类Dev

通过函数传递对象

来自分类Dev

通过引用传递对象

来自分类Dev

通过 Segue 将对象从表视图单元格传递到另一个视图控制器

来自分类Dev

通过构造函数传递对象?

来自分类Dev

通过引用传递StreamReader对象

来自分类Dev

通过构造函数传递对象?

来自分类Dev

通过http传递复杂对象

来自分类Dev

Xaml通过命令传递对象

来自分类Dev

通过引用传递指向的对象

来自分类Dev

UITextfield作为float通过segue传递给UILabel

来自分类Dev

通过segue传递值以编程方式生成按钮

来自分类Dev

如何获取 json 数据以通过 segue 传递它

来自分类Dev

Rails通过表单选择传递对象

来自分类Dev

Node.js-通过require传递对象

来自分类Dev

减少通过函数传递多个对象的重复

来自分类Dev

在C ++中通过引用传递对象

来自分类Dev

通过ajax请求传递js对象

来自分类Dev

通过引用传递PDO连接对象?

来自分类Dev

压缩Arraylist或通过对象传递arraylist